3.1 Choosing the Right Location for the Detector
Place the detector near sleeping areas and on every level of your home for maximum effectiveness. Install it at least 5 feet above the floor to avoid false alarms. Avoid areas near vents, direct sunlight, or extreme temperatures. Ensure it’s not obstructed by furniture or curtains. Check local regulations for specific placement requirements. Install multiple detectors for comprehensive coverage.

4.1 Regular Maintenance Tips for Optimal Performance
Ensure your Garrison detector works efficiently by replacing batteries annually, cleaning dust with a soft brush, and testing functionality monthly. Check for obstructions near the sensor and avoid placing detectors near direct sunlight or moisture. Inspect expiration dates and replace units as recommended. Regular maintenance ensures accurate detection and keeps your family safe from potential carbon monoxide threats year-round.
4.2 Common Issues and Solutions (e.g., Beeping Alarm)
If your Garrison detector beeps, check for low battery or high CO levels. Replace batteries or plug in the unit if hardwired. Ensure no obstructions block the sensor. Press the Test/Reset button to silence the alarm after addressing the issue. If beeping persists, inspect for sensor damage or expiration. Regularly cleaning the detector and ensuring proper placement can prevent false alarms and maintain reliability. Always refer to the manual for troubleshooting guidance.

6.2 Advantages of Hardwired Carbon Monoxide Alarms
Hardwired carbon monoxide alarms provide reliable, continuous power and eliminate the need for frequent battery replacements. They often feature interconnectivity, allowing multiple detectors to sound an alarm simultaneously. This ensures comprehensive coverage and faster response times. Hardwired models also reduce false alarms caused by low battery levels. With a built-in power supply, they offer long-term durability and enhanced safety for your home, making them a superior choice for whole-house protection.

7.2 Responding to a CO Alarm Activation
If your Garrison carbon monoxide detector activates, immediately move to fresh air outdoors or by an open window. Ensure all family members are present. Do not re-enter the premises until the alarm stops. Check for potential CO sources, such as faulty appliances, and contact emergency services or a professional. Silence the alarm using the Test/Reset button, but only after ensuring the environment is safe.

8.1 Preventing CO Buildup in Your Home
Prevent CO buildup by ensuring proper installation and maintenance of fuel-burning appliances. Keep vents clear, use fans, and open windows for ventilation. Regularly inspect chimneys and flues. Never run generators indoors or near windows. Maintain your heating system annually to prevent leaks. Avoid blocked vents, as this can cause CO accumulation. Stay vigilant to reduce risks and ensure a safe living environment.
8.2 Emergency Procedures for CO Exposure
If your Garrison CO detector activates, exit immediately. Open windows if safe. Move to fresh air, ventilate the area if possible, check everyone’s condition, and call emergency services. Do not re-enter until cleared. Turn off appliances if possible. Stay calm and follow safety guidelines for everyone’s safety.
